THE driver of a money transport van who allegedly made off with around €3 million in cash has been arrested in north France.

Adien Derbez, aged 27, who had allegedly fled with the money while in the outskirts of Paris, was detained near Amiens stations as he reportedly tried to escape out of the window of an apartment he had been hiding in.

French police had spoken about concerns a rifle in the vehicle had also gone missing, however Deernez was said to have been arrested without the use of gun fire. Officers said they are now investigating whether the suspect had any accomplices.
